Subject: Re: [PATCH v2 2/3] bpf: do not walk twice the hash map on free

On Apr 30 2024, Benjamin Tissoires wrote:
> If someone stores both a timer and a workqueue in a hash map, on free, we
> would walk it twice.
> Add a check in htab_free_malloced_timers_or_wq and free the timers
> and workqueues if they are present.

> +		if (btf_record_has_field(htab->map.record, BPF_TIMER))
> +			bpf_obj_free_timer(htab->map.record,
> +					   elem->key + round_up(htab->map.key_size, 8));
> +		else

Sorry, this else above is wrong, it should be a check on BPF_WORKQUEUE
instead.

v3 is n its way (with the proper bpf-next suffix this time).
